u****p 发帖数: 526 | 1 被问到一个debug的问题,如果一个明星update了一个新的状态,但是其他人看不到这
个新的状态, 请问如果找出原因? |
G**O 发帖数: 147 | 2 。。。不要先知道他们系统是怎么 fan out的么?
不知道? 那就问呀
比如人家是 fan-out-on write, 是不是write地方出问题了?没有写到正确的地方?
是一个人看不到还是一部分人看不到?还是都看不到?
是刚发的时候看不到还是一直就看不到?
如果是 fan out on read, 那么read 生成feed的时候是不是有问题,比如你paging没
有做好,每次生成top 50, 后面的丢掉或者有gap,是不是这个明星update正好rank 51
就被丢了?
总之就是客官您得告诉我您要什么姿势,小妹妹我才能配合是不?
love u
【在 u****p 的大作中提到】 : 被问到一个debug的问题,如果一个明星update了一个新的状态,但是其他人看不到这 : 个新的状态, 请问如果找出原因?
|
y**********u 发帖数: 2839 | 3 满分!
吻你
[在 GPRO (GoPro) 的大作中提到:]
:。。。不要先知道他们系统是怎么 fan out的么?
:不知道? 那就问呀
:比如人家是 fan-out-on write, 是不是write地方出问题了?没有写到正确的地方
?是一个人看不到还是一部分人看不到?还是都看不到?
:是刚发的时候看不到还是一直就看不到?
:如果是 fan out on read, 那么read 生成feed的时候是不是有问题,比如你paging没
:有做好,每次生成top 50, 后面的丢掉或者有gap,是不是这个明星update正好rank
51就被丢了?
:总之就是客官您得告诉我您要什么姿势,小妹妹我才能配合是不?
:love u |
H**********5 发帖数: 2012 | 4 面试官默默流泪了,到底是你问问题还是我问问题
开个玩笑
51
【在 G**O 的大作中提到】 : 。。。不要先知道他们系统是怎么 fan out的么? : 不知道? 那就问呀 : 比如人家是 fan-out-on write, 是不是write地方出问题了?没有写到正确的地方? : 是一个人看不到还是一部分人看不到?还是都看不到? : 是刚发的时候看不到还是一直就看不到? : 如果是 fan out on read, 那么read 生成feed的时候是不是有问题,比如你paging没 : 有做好,每次生成top 50, 后面的丢掉或者有gap,是不是这个明星update正好rank 51 : 就被丢了? : 总之就是客官您得告诉我您要什么姿势,小妹妹我才能配合是不? : love u
|
u****p 发帖数: 526 | 5 问了write没有问题,database里也能查到更新,但是其他用户看不到。问了多少用户
看不到,他说假设全部用户看不到,是刚更新的几分钟看不到(之后能不能看到我没问
)。
如果是全部用户看不到是什么问题?如果一个人看不到是什么问题?
几分钟看不到是什么问题?之后一直不能看到是什么问题?
多谢啊
51
【在 G**O 的大作中提到】 : 。。。不要先知道他们系统是怎么 fan out的么? : 不知道? 那就问呀 : 比如人家是 fan-out-on write, 是不是write地方出问题了?没有写到正确的地方? : 是一个人看不到还是一部分人看不到?还是都看不到? : 是刚发的时候看不到还是一直就看不到? : 如果是 fan out on read, 那么read 生成feed的时候是不是有问题,比如你paging没 : 有做好,每次生成top 50, 后面的丢掉或者有gap,是不是这个明星update正好rank 51 : 就被丢了? : 总之就是客官您得告诉我您要什么姿势,小妹妹我才能配合是不? : love u
|
d******c 发帖数: 2407 | 6 你把整个流程每个阶段画出来,确认的话应该不难对每一个问题找出可能的原因。
具体流程不清楚别人也不好回答。
【在 u****p 的大作中提到】 : 问了write没有问题,database里也能查到更新,但是其他用户看不到。问了多少用户 : 看不到,他说假设全部用户看不到,是刚更新的几分钟看不到(之后能不能看到我没问 : )。 : 如果是全部用户看不到是什么问题?如果一个人看不到是什么问题? : 几分钟看不到是什么问题?之后一直不能看到是什么问题? : 多谢啊 : : 51
|
z*********n 发帖数: 1451 | 7
所以总结下你说的题设:
push mode
明星
刚更新的几分中内看不到
这么看面试官是想考你知不知道push mode的先天缺陷--就是明星问题:粉丝太多,
pipeline带宽有限,延迟过大。我觉着你可以顺着这个思路答下去或者继续追问。
当然,这问题可以有100种答案,但我觉着上面那个思路是面试官脑子里那个。面试官
有几个真正主导设计过这种系统的,他知道的也无非是网上文章里那些,那就是我上面
说的那部分了。
【在 u****p 的大作中提到】 : 问了write没有问题,database里也能查到更新,但是其他用户看不到。问了多少用户 : 看不到,他说假设全部用户看不到,是刚更新的几分钟看不到(之后能不能看到我没问 : )。 : 如果是全部用户看不到是什么问题?如果一个人看不到是什么问题? : 几分钟看不到是什么问题?之后一直不能看到是什么问题? : 多谢啊 : : 51
|
G**O 发帖数: 147 | 8 精肛说得对。
其实面试官无非就是要看你知道几种姿势,顺着人家说就好了,最后摆出啥姿势未必特
别重要啦。
【在 z*********n 的大作中提到】 : : 所以总结下你说的题设: : push mode : 明星 : 刚更新的几分中内看不到 : 这么看面试官是想考你知不知道push mode的先天缺陷--就是明星问题:粉丝太多, : pipeline带宽有限,延迟过大。我觉着你可以顺着这个思路答下去或者继续追问。 : 当然,这问题可以有100种答案,但我觉着上面那个思路是面试官脑子里那个。面试官 : 有几个真正主导设计过这种系统的,他知道的也无非是网上文章里那些,那就是我上面 : 说的那部分了。
|
z*********n 发帖数: 1451 | 9
不仅如此,还要更进一步:客人使个眼色,你猜出来客人脑子里想的哪种姿势,然后主
动贴上去提供
【在 G**O 的大作中提到】 : 精肛说得对。 : 其实面试官无非就是要看你知道几种姿势,顺着人家说就好了,最后摆出啥姿势未必特 : 别重要啦。
|
u****p 发帖数: 526 | 10 多谢啊,我想问问看不看的到更新和有没有follow这个明星有关吗?
另外当时问的思路是怎么着手debug相关问题,如果看不到有什么可能性?
【在 z*********n 的大作中提到】 : : 不仅如此,还要更进一步:客人使个眼色,你猜出来客人脑子里想的哪种姿势,然后主 : 动贴上去提供
|
u****p 发帖数: 526 | |
z*********n 发帖数: 1451 | 12
你当然得先follow了才能看更新了,你得先了解你的产品。。
有什么可能性我不是已经说了吗?
【在 u****p 的大作中提到】 : 多谢啊,我想问问看不看的到更新和有没有follow这个明星有关吗? : 另外当时问的思路是怎么着手debug相关问题,如果看不到有什么可能性?
|